Transaction 373f51bb2f69b5a2c9013ab6a602a1c0fda4def00f17eb866a25b699f0260bd8

1 Input
2 Outputs
  • 373f51bb2f69b5a2c9013ab6a602a1c0fda4def00f17eb866a25b699f0260bd8:0
  • value  8592292
    address  15aheFD3BVQMJ23J3NotKcE4MhirLzno68
  • 373f51bb2f69b5a2c9013ab6a602a1c0fda4def00f17eb866a25b699f0260bd8:1
  • value  103312405
    address  3G1nGx56RyQgK2X48fhbe58vToBKmfXnPU